In November and December 1968, several unexplained aerial phenomena were reported in Puente Almuhey, a small town in León, Spain. Testimonies collected by the Spanish Air Force describe luminous objects with varying shapes and colors, observed for periods ranging from 10 minutes to two hours. One notable incident occurred on November 24, when two witnesses saw a reddish, disc-shaped object that disassembled and reassembled. Other sightings, such as those on December 8 and 10, reported white or yellowish lights with slow movement and no noise. Despite discrepancies in the descriptions, investigators concluded there was no clear explanation based on known atmospheric or astronomical phenomena. The file, initially classified, was declassified decades later, leaving more questions than answers about what happened in that rural area of Spain.
